📄 etx_traffic.tcl
字号:
$ns_ connect $tcp_(69) $sink_(69) set ftp_(69) [new Application/FTP] $ftp_(69) attach-agent $tcp_(69) $ns_ at 5.717686 "$ftp_(69) start" set tcp_(71) [new Agent/TCP] $tcp_(71) set class_ 2 set sink_(71) [new Agent/TCPSink]# DOWNLINK: From GW $node_(70) to $node_(71) $ns_ attach-agent $node_(70) $tcp_(71) $ns_ attach-agent $node_(71) $sink_(71) $ns_ connect $tcp_(71) $sink_(71) set ftp_(71) [new Application/FTP] $ftp_(71) attach-agent $tcp_(71) $ns_ at 5.207730 "$ftp_(71) start" set tcp_(72) [new Agent/TCP] $tcp_(72) set class_ 2 set sink_(72) [new Agent/TCPSink]# DOWNLINK: From GW $node_(70) to $node_(72) $ns_ attach-agent $node_(70) $tcp_(72) $ns_ attach-agent $node_(72) $sink_(72) $ns_ connect $tcp_(72) $sink_(72) set ftp_(72) [new Application/FTP] $ftp_(72) attach-agent $tcp_(72) $ns_ at 5.371582 "$ftp_(72) start" set tcp_(73) [new Agent/TCP] $tcp_(73) set class_ 2 set sink_(73) [new Agent/TCPSink]# DOWNLINK: From GW $node_(84) to $node_(73) $ns_ attach-agent $node_(84) $tcp_(73) $ns_ attach-agent $node_(73) $sink_(73) $ns_ connect $tcp_(73) $sink_(73) set ftp_(73) [new Application/FTP] $ftp_(73) attach-agent $tcp_(73) $ns_ at 5.585449 "$ftp_(73) start" set tcp_(74) [new Agent/TCP] $tcp_(74) set class_ 2 set sink_(74) [new Agent/TCPSink]# DOWNLINK: From GW $node_(64) to $node_(74) $ns_ attach-agent $node_(64) $tcp_(74) $ns_ attach-agent $node_(74) $sink_(74) $ns_ connect $tcp_(74) $sink_(74) set ftp_(74) [new Application/FTP] $ftp_(74) attach-agent $tcp_(74) $ns_ at 5.729014 "$ftp_(74) start" set tcp_(75) [new Agent/TCP] $tcp_(75) set class_ 2 set sink_(75) [new Agent/TCPSink]# DOWNLINK: From GW $node_(84) to $node_(75) $ns_ attach-agent $node_(84) $tcp_(75) $ns_ attach-agent $node_(75) $sink_(75) $ns_ connect $tcp_(75) $sink_(75) set ftp_(75) [new Application/FTP] $ftp_(75) attach-agent $tcp_(75) $ns_ at 5.598920 "$ftp_(75) start" set tcp_(76) [new Agent/TCP] $tcp_(76) set class_ 2 set sink_(76) [new Agent/TCPSink]# DOWNLINK: From GW $node_(84) to $node_(76) $ns_ attach-agent $node_(84) $tcp_(76) $ns_ attach-agent $node_(76) $sink_(76) $ns_ connect $tcp_(76) $sink_(76) set ftp_(76) [new Application/FTP] $ftp_(76) attach-agent $tcp_(76) $ns_ at 5.369434 "$ftp_(76) start" set tcp_(77) [new Agent/TCP] $tcp_(77) set class_ 2 set sink_(77) [new Agent/TCPSink]# DOWNLINK: From GW $node_(87) to $node_(77) $ns_ attach-agent $node_(87) $tcp_(77) $ns_ attach-agent $node_(77) $sink_(77) $ns_ connect $tcp_(77) $sink_(77) set ftp_(77) [new Application/FTP] $ftp_(77) attach-agent $tcp_(77) $ns_ at 5.494670 "$ftp_(77) start" set tcp_(78) [new Agent/TCP] $tcp_(78) set class_ 2 set sink_(78) [new Agent/TCPSink]# DOWNLINK: From GW $node_(87) to $node_(78) $ns_ attach-agent $node_(87) $tcp_(78) $ns_ attach-agent $node_(78) $sink_(78) $ns_ connect $tcp_(78) $sink_(78) set ftp_(78) [new Application/FTP] $ftp_(78) attach-agent $tcp_(78) $ns_ at 5.641396 "$ftp_(78) start" set tcp_(79) [new Agent/TCP] $tcp_(79) set class_ 2 set sink_(79) [new Agent/TCPSink]# DOWNLINK: From GW $node_(87) to $node_(79) $ns_ attach-agent $node_(87) $tcp_(79) $ns_ attach-agent $node_(79) $sink_(79) $ns_ connect $tcp_(79) $sink_(79) set ftp_(79) [new Application/FTP] $ftp_(79) attach-agent $tcp_(79) $ns_ at 5.066706 "$ftp_(79) start" set tcp_(80) [new Agent/TCP] $tcp_(80) set class_ 2 set sink_(80) [new Agent/TCPSink]# DOWNLINK: From GW $node_(70) to $node_(80) $ns_ attach-agent $node_(70) $tcp_(80) $ns_ attach-agent $node_(80) $sink_(80) $ns_ connect $tcp_(80) $sink_(80) set ftp_(80) [new Application/FTP] $ftp_(80) attach-agent $tcp_(80) $ns_ at 5.919896 "$ftp_(80) start" set tcp_(81) [new Agent/TCP] $tcp_(81) set class_ 2 set sink_(81) [new Agent/TCPSink]# DOWNLINK: From GW $node_(70) to $node_(81) $ns_ attach-agent $node_(70) $tcp_(81) $ns_ attach-agent $node_(81) $sink_(81) $ns_ connect $tcp_(81) $sink_(81) set ftp_(81) [new Application/FTP] $ftp_(81) attach-agent $tcp_(81) $ns_ at 5.139100 "$ftp_(81) start" set tcp_(82) [new Agent/TCP] $tcp_(82) set class_ 2 set sink_(82) [new Agent/TCPSink]# DOWNLINK: From GW $node_(84) to $node_(82) $ns_ attach-agent $node_(84) $tcp_(82) $ns_ attach-agent $node_(82) $sink_(82) $ns_ connect $tcp_(82) $sink_(82) set ftp_(82) [new Application/FTP] $ftp_(82) attach-agent $tcp_(82) $ns_ at 5.346310 "$ftp_(82) start" set tcp_(83) [new Agent/TCP] $tcp_(83) set class_ 2 set sink_(83) [new Agent/TCPSink]# DOWNLINK: From GW $node_(84) to $node_(83) $ns_ attach-agent $node_(84) $tcp_(83) $ns_ attach-agent $node_(83) $sink_(83) $ns_ connect $tcp_(83) $sink_(83) set ftp_(83) [new Application/FTP] $ftp_(83) attach-agent $tcp_(83) $ns_ at 5.959250 "$ftp_(83) start" set tcp_(85) [new Agent/TCP] $tcp_(85) set class_ 2 set sink_(85) [new Agent/TCPSink]# DOWNLINK: From GW $node_(84) to $node_(85) $ns_ attach-agent $node_(84) $tcp_(85) $ns_ attach-agent $node_(85) $sink_(85) $ns_ connect $tcp_(85) $sink_(85) set ftp_(85) [new Application/FTP] $ftp_(85) attach-agent $tcp_(85) $ns_ at 5.346090 "$ftp_(85) start" set tcp_(86) [new Agent/TCP] $tcp_(86) set class_ 2 set sink_(86) [new Agent/TCPSink]# DOWNLINK: From GW $node_(87) to $node_(86) $ns_ attach-agent $node_(87) $tcp_(86) $ns_ attach-agent $node_(86) $sink_(86) $ns_ connect $tcp_(86) $sink_(86) set ftp_(86) [new Application/FTP] $ftp_(86) attach-agent $tcp_(86) $ns_ at 5.394254 "$ftp_(86) start" set tcp_(88) [new Agent/TCP] $tcp_(88) set class_ 2 set sink_(88) [new Agent/TCPSink]# DOWNLINK: From GW $node_(87) to $node_(88) $ns_ attach-agent $node_(87) $tcp_(88) $ns_ attach-agent $node_(88) $sink_(88) $ns_ connect $tcp_(88) $sink_(88) set ftp_(88) [new Application/FTP] $ftp_(88) attach-agent $tcp_(88) $ns_ at 5.617224 "$ftp_(88) start" set tcp_(89) [new Agent/TCP] $tcp_(89) set class_ 2 set sink_(89) [new Agent/TCPSink]# DOWNLINK: From GW $node_(87) to $node_(89) $ns_ attach-agent $node_(87) $tcp_(89) $ns_ attach-agent $node_(89) $sink_(89) $ns_ connect $tcp_(89) $sink_(89) set ftp_(89) [new Application/FTP] $ftp_(89) attach-agent $tcp_(89) $ns_ at 5.325167 "$ftp_(89) start" set tcp_(90) [new Agent/TCP] $tcp_(90) set class_ 2 set sink_(90) [new Agent/TCPSink]# DOWNLINK: From GW $node_(70) to $node_(90) $ns_ attach-agent $node_(70) $tcp_(90) $ns_ attach-agent $node_(90) $sink_(90) $ns_ connect $tcp_(90) $sink_(90) set ftp_(90) [new Application/FTP] $ftp_(90) attach-agent $tcp_(90) $ns_ at 5.086649 "$ftp_(90) start" set tcp_(91) [new Agent/TCP] $tcp_(91) set class_ 2 set sink_(91) [new Agent/TCPSink]# DOWNLINK: From GW $node_(84) to $node_(91) $ns_ attach-agent $node_(84) $tcp_(91) $ns_ attach-agent $node_(91) $sink_(91) $ns_ connect $tcp_(91) $sink_(91) set ftp_(91) [new Application/FTP] $ftp_(91) attach-agent $tcp_(91) $ns_ at 5.705836 "$ftp_(91) start" set tcp_(92) [new Agent/TCP] $tcp_(92) set class_ 2 set sink_(92) [new Agent/TCPSink]# DOWNLINK: From GW $node_(84) to $node_(92) $ns_ attach-agent $node_(84) $tcp_(92) $ns_ attach-agent $node_(92) $sink_(92) $ns_ connect $tcp_(92) $sink_(92) set ftp_(92) [new Application/FTP] $ftp_(92) attach-agent $tcp_(92) $ns_ at 5.920889 "$ftp_(92) start" set tcp_(93) [new Agent/TCP] $tcp_(93) set class_ 2 set sink_(93) [new Agent/TCPSink]# DOWNLINK: From GW $node_(84) to $node_(93) $ns_ attach-agent $node_(84) $tcp_(93) $ns_ attach-agent $node_(93) $sink_(93) $ns_ connect $tcp_(93) $sink_(93) set ftp_(93) [new Application/FTP] $ftp_(93) attach-agent $tcp_(93) $ns_ at 5.116698 "$ftp_(93) start" set tcp_(94) [new Agent/TCP] $tcp_(94) set class_ 2 set sink_(94) [new Agent/TCPSink]# DOWNLINK: From GW $node_(84) to $node_(94) $ns_ attach-agent $node_(84) $tcp_(94) $ns_ attach-agent $node_(94) $sink_(94) $ns_ connect $tcp_(94) $sink_(94) set ftp_(94) [new Application/FTP] $ftp_(94) attach-agent $tcp_(94) $ns_ at 5.165538 "$ftp_(94) start" set tcp_(95) [new Agent/TCP] $tcp_(95) set class_ 2 set sink_(95) [new Agent/TCPSink]# DOWNLINK: From GW $node_(87) to $node_(95) $ns_ attach-agent $node_(87) $tcp_(95) $ns_ attach-agent $node_(95) $sink_(95) $ns_ connect $tcp_(95) $sink_(95) set ftp_(95) [new Application/FTP] $ftp_(95) attach-agent $tcp_(95) $ns_ at 5.845082 "$ftp_(95) start" set tcp_(96) [new Agent/TCP] $tcp_(96) set class_ 2 set sink_(96) [new Agent/TCPSink]# DOWNLINK: From GW $node_(87) to $node_(96) $ns_ attach-agent $node_(87) $tcp_(96) $ns_ attach-agent $node_(96) $sink_(96) $ns_ connect $tcp_(96) $sink_(96) set ftp_(96) [new Application/FTP] $ftp_(96) attach-agent $tcp_(96) $ns_ at 5.458643 "$ftp_(96) start" set tcp_(97) [new Agent/TCP] $tcp_(97) set class_ 2 set sink_(97) [new Agent/TCPSink]# DOWNLINK: From GW $node_(87) to $node_(97) $ns_ attach-agent $node_(87) $tcp_(97) $ns_ attach-agent $node_(97) $sink_(97) $ns_ connect $tcp_(97) $sink_(97) set ftp_(97) [new Application/FTP] $ftp_(97) attach-agent $tcp_(97) $ns_ at 5.052165 "$ftp_(97) start" set tcp_(98) [new Agent/TCP] $tcp_(98) set class_ 2 set sink_(98) [new Agent/TCPSink]# DOWNLINK: From GW $node_(87) to $node_(98) $ns_ attach-agent $node_(87) $tcp_(98) $ns_ attach-agent $node_(98) $sink_(98) $ns_ connect $tcp_(98) $sink_(98) set ftp_(98) [new Application/FTP] $ftp_(98) attach-agent $tcp_(98) $ns_ at 5.823381 "$ftp_(98) start" set tcp_(99) [new Agent/TCP] $tcp_(99) set class_ 2 set sink_(99) [new Agent/TCPSink]# DOWNLINK: From GW $node_(87) to $node_(99) $ns_ attach-agent $node_(87) $tcp_(99) $ns_ attach-agent $node_(99) $sink_(99) $ns_ connect $tcp_(99) $sink_(99) set ftp_(99) [new Application/FTP] $ftp_(99) attach-agent $tcp_(99) $ns_ at 5.852051 "$ftp_(99) start" # MAC SETTINGS set opt(ARF) 1; # ARFset opt(INIT_RATE) 5;Mac/802_11 set ShortRetryLimit_ 7; # Use default schemeMac/802_11 set LongRetryLimit_ 4; # # MAC: Use multi-rate, multi-SINR 802.11g links with ARF$mac_(0) setup-link [$mac_(3) id] $opt(ARF) $opt(INIT_RATE)$mac_(3) setup-link [$mac_(0) id] $opt(ARF) $opt(INIT_RATE)$mac_(1) setup-link [$mac_(2) id] $opt(ARF) $opt(INIT_RATE)$mac_(2) setup-link [$mac_(1) id] $opt(ARF) $opt(INIT_RATE)$mac_(2) setup-link [$mac_(3) id] $opt(ARF) $opt(INIT_RATE)$mac_(3) setup-link [$mac_(2) id] $opt(ARF) $opt(INIT_RATE)$mac_(4) setup-link [$mac_(3) id] $opt(ARF) $opt(INIT_RATE)$mac_(3) setup-link [$mac_(4) id] $opt(ARF) $opt(INIT_RATE)$mac_(6) setup-link [$mac_(5) id] $opt(ARF) $opt(INIT_RATE)$mac_(5) setup-link [$mac_(6) id] $opt(ARF) $opt(INIT_RATE)$mac_(7) setup-link [$mac_(16) id] $opt(ARF) $opt(INIT_RATE)$mac_(16) setup-link [$mac_(7) id] $opt(ARF) $opt(INIT_RATE)$mac_(8) setup-link [$mac_(16) id] $opt(ARF) $opt(INIT_RATE)$mac_(16) setup-link [$mac_(8) id] $opt(ARF) $opt(INIT_RATE)$mac_(9) setup-link [$mac_(5) id] $opt(ARF) $opt(INIT_RATE)$mac_(5) setup-link [$mac_(9) id] $opt(ARF) $opt(INIT_RATE)$mac_(10) setup-link [$mac_(31) id] $opt(ARF) $opt(INIT_RATE)$mac_(31) setup-link [$mac_(10) id] $opt(ARF) $opt(INIT_RATE)$mac_(11) setup-link [$mac_(3) id] $opt(ARF) $opt(INIT_RATE)$mac_(3) setup-link [$mac_(11) id] $opt(ARF) $opt(INIT_RATE)$mac_(12) setup-link [$mac_(3) id] $opt(ARF) $opt(INIT_RATE)$mac_(3) setup-link [$mac_(12) id] $opt(ARF) $opt(INIT_RATE)$mac_(13) setup-link [$mac_(3) id] $opt(ARF) $opt(INIT_RATE)
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-